Some of the more dangerous token decks dont have to pick a single route to victory either they can attack the table on multiple axes, creating no-win situations for unwitting opponents who wait a little too long to address the swelling ranks of a token players creatures
Board wipes like Austere Command, Cleansing Nova, Damnation, Toxic Deluge, Cyclonic Rift, Rivers Rebuke, Blasphemous Act, Vandalblast, and All is Dust are almost always worth having on hand in some capacity

Flanking means "Whenever a creature without flanking blocks this creature, the blocking creature gets -1/-1 until end of turn." If a creature gains flanking during combat, that has no effect on any creature already blocking it
